Description

The N12000PRO 12-Bay Enterprise-Class NAS Server from Thecus is designed to meet the needs of large businesses dealing with large amount of data. With unified storage, the users will have the ability to plug their NAS to an iSCSI network, and at the same time, can use the Thecus NAS as an IP Storage pool for both protocols. This way, the NAS can be compatible with any existing or future architecture.

It is powered by the Intel Xeon E3-1275 processor that runs at 3.4 GHz. The quad-core processor is matched by 8GB of DDR3 RAM to ensure that even complex commands are executed without any glitch. To ensure optimal utilization of the processors, a PCI-e slot is provided to accommodate a 10GbE network card (sold separately), which along with link aggregation can be used to streamline the data traffic over the network.

Brought on by the ThecusOS 5.0, you can now dynamically stack your NAS units for obtaining more capacity on a single volume. This can be achieved by designating your N12000PRO as a stack master and implementing a 10GbE switch. A maximum of 8 target devices can be intertwined for a massive volume of multi TB capacity when utilizing 10GbE switch.

Up to 4 D16000 DAS can be daisy-chained to your N12000PRO NAS server to achieve an additional 64 bays of storage. As a result, massive expansions can be achieved to meet the needs of large capacity storage requirements. The SAS cables that are used to daisy-chain the DAS to the NAS help enhance data transfer speeds. If paired with volume expansion, daisy-chain can be used to expand storage capacity to up to 2.5PB.

The N12000PRO runs on ThecusOSTM 5.0, which supports the High Availability feature. High Availability allows you to replicate the data on an active NAS to another standby NAS via 10GbE synchronization. If data corruption occurs or if the active NAS has any HDD problems or downtime, then the standby server keeps all vital data saved and is available at all times to take over the active NAS’s responsibilities.

The N12000PRO supports Data Guard, a total back-up solution. It provides both local and remote backup under one roof. Currently, data is backed up across several RAID volumes, external USB drives, and eSATA. In addition, Data Guard is used to sync data across the network to other NAS, in order to take advantage of real-time remote replication to keep your data safe. High Availability (System Redundancy)
High Availability is achieved by keeping data on 2 separate, identical NAS (Network Area Storage), which allows for convenient delay-free access to your data. If one needs maintenance, the other will take its place without affecting system performance.

Link Aggregation
Link aggregation can sustain multiple network connections and provide redundancy in case one of the links fails. Thecus NAS supports 7 modes which provide Load Balance, Failover, 802.3ad, Balance-XOR, Balance-TLB and Balance-ALB, and Broadcast.
Data Guard
Data Guard backup software solution provides a user-friendly and convenient way to back up data on both a local and remote machines. Data can be backed up across RAID volumes, external USB drives, and eSATA at the host location or on other NAS servers at remote locations via a network.

Multiple RAID
Create multiple RAID volumes each supporting different RAID modes, including RAID 0, 1, 5, 6, 10, 50, 60, and JBOD for your own balance of performance and data protection. If a hard drive malfunction ever occurs, the lost data can be recovered using online RAID migration and expansion, hot spare, and auto rebuild.
Multiple File Systems
Support for multiple file systems including EXT3, EXT4, and XFS, gives the Thecus NAS flexibility to handle many different types of environments. Users can simultaneously use different file systems across multiple RAID volumes to make optimal use for each disk.
